    Opening Statement

    Central Coast Waldorf School, on the Central Coast of California, is seeking an enthusiastic Spanish teacher who brings joy, warmth, and creativity to the classroom. The ideal candidate is inspired by the developmental approach of Waldorf education, is a native speaker and can engage students through songs, stories, conversation, games, cultural activities and grammar in the Spanish language. This position offers the opportunity to work in a supportive and collaborative community, where professionalism, growth, and a love for teaching are highly valued.

     

    About

    Central Coast Waldorf School is a vibrant school with 130 children, from preschool through 8th grade. We are a 17-year-old school with healthy enrollment, strong community support and we are certified by WECAN and AWSNA. We offer specialty programs in Spanish, Math, Handwork, Movement, Strings Ensemble, and Education Support.     Essential Job Duties

    Key Responsibilities:

    • Plan and teach Spanish language classes in grades 1st - 8th

    • Assess student proficiency and write reports 2 times per year

    • Create a dynamic and engaging classroom environment that encourages speaking, listening, and thinking in Spanish

    • Collaborate and communicate with lead class teachers and parents

    • Contribute to school festivals, events, and performances

    • Perform recess supervision duties

    • Participate in professional development and ongoing study of Waldorf education

    • Participate in all-faculty meetings

    Key Responsibilities:
    • Teach 1st grade students, following the Waldorf curriculum and supporting the intellectual, social, and emotional development of each child.
    • Create a dynamic and engaging classroom environment that encourages creativity, critical thinking, and exploration.
    • Foster a deep connection with students, modeling respect, kindness, and responsibility.
    • Integrate subject areas in a way that sparks curiosity and imagination, including the main lessons, arts, music, movement, and practical activities.
    • Provide individual support and work with our educational support teacher as needed to meet the diverse needs of students.
    • Communicate effectively with parents about student progress, challenges, and school events.
    • Collaborate with colleagues on school-wide initiatives, festivals, and community activities.
    • Engage in ongoing professional development to continue growing as a Waldorf educator.
